🌿 Organic Certificate in India 🌿
The Organic Certificate in India is a certification that ensures agricultural products are cultivated using organic farming methods, which emphasize sustainability, biodiversity, and the absence of synthetic chemicals. This certification assures consumers that the products meet the National Program for Organic Production (NPOP) standards set by the Government of India and have undergone rigorous inspections and audits to verify their compliance.
🇮🇳 Organic Certification in India:
- The NPOP (National Program for Organic Production) is the Indian standard for organic farming, regulated by the APEDA (Agricultural and Processed Food Products Export Development Authority).
- India Organic Certification: This is the official organic certification logo authorized by the government to be used on certified organic products within India and for exports.
🔑 Key Principles of Organic Certification:
- No synthetic chemicals: Products must be free from synthetic pesticides, herbicides, and fertilizers 🚫
- Soil health: Organic farming promotes soil fertility through compost, green manure, and crop rotation 🌾
- Biodiversity: Encourages the use of diverse plants and animals to maintain ecosystem balance 🐝
- Sustainability: Focuses on long-term environmental sustainability and the well-being of farmers 🌍
🌱 Benefits of Organic Certification for Indian Farmers and Producers:
- Market Access: Organic certification opens doors to domestic and international markets that value organic products 🌏
- Consumer Trust: Builds consumer confidence in the quality and authenticity of organic products ✅
- Environmental Impact: Encourages sustainable farming practices that protect the environment 🌱
- Higher Demand and Premium Prices: Organic products often command higher prices due to the increasing demand for healthy, chemical-free food 💰
The Organic Certificate in India is vital for producers wishing to promote environmentally friendly farming practices and tap into the growing organic market, both locally and globally.
